WebIf you plan to rotate your horseradish annually for pest and disease prevention, then you can store some of your root cuttings to use to plant next year. Make sure to save roots from healthy plants that are free from defects like dark spots or streaks. Using this method, you are technically replanting new horseradish plants each year. WebDig with a shovel about eight inches around the plant, being careful not to damage the root. Finish the process by hand. If possible, you’d like an 8 – 10” unbroken root. We have clay so ours are about 6 – 8”. Place harvested roots in a paper bag and in the refrigerator until you are ready to process it. Ideally this should be done the same day. WebJun 28, 2024 · Set the horseradish root cuttings or “sets” either vertically or at a 45-degree angle, spaced one foot (31 cm.) apart from each other. Cover the roots with 2 to 3 inches (5-8 cm.) of soil. Mulch around the plants with …

WebNov 16, 2024 · The best time to dig up horseradish root is late fall or early winter, after the leaves have died back. You can also dig up the root in early spring, before new growth begins. To dig up the root, use a shovel or spade to loosen the soil around the plant, then lift the root out of the ground. 2. WebDec 31, 2024 · How to Plant Horseradish. The easiest way to plant horseradish is to dig a trench that is 5-6” deep. Plant each separate root 12-18” apart in rows spaced a few feet apart. When you examine your horseradish sets, you should see that one end of the root is cut squarely while the other end is cut at an angle.

WebOct 29, 2024 · Plant horseradish in early spring as soon as the soil can be worked. Choose a location in full sun with moist, fertile and medium heavy soil. Horseradish is a perennial crop, so choose a planting site where the roots may spread undisturbed. Prepare the bed by turning the soil under to a depth of 8 inches.
